Ingredients
- 1 pound carrots, peeled and cut into 2-inch pieces
- 1 pound fresh green beans, trimmed
- 3 tablespoons butter, melted
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
- Optional: 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ley for garnish
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ease it.
Step 2: In a small bowl, whisk together the melted butter, honey, minced garlic, olive oil, thyme, salt, and pepper until well combined.
Step 3: Place the carrots and green beans in a large mixing bowl. Pour the honey butter mixture over the vegetables and toss until evenly coated.
Step 4: Spread the vegetables in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et, making sure they’re not overcrowded to ensure even roasting.
Step 5: Roast for 20-25 minutes, stirring halfway through, until the carrots are tender and the green beans are crisp-tender with slightly caramelized edges.
Step 6: Remove from oven and transfer to a serving dish. Garnish with fresh parsley if desired and serve immediately.
Expert Tips for Perfect Results
Cut vegetables evenly: Make sure your carrot pieces are roughly the same size so they cook at the same rate. This prevents some pieces from being overcooked while others are still hard.
Don’t overcrowd the pan: Giving the vegetables space allows them to roast rather than steam, creating that beautiful caramelization that makes this dish so delicious.
Adjust sweetness: If you prefer a less sweet glaze, reduce the honey to 1 tablespoon and add an extra tablespoon of butter. For extra flavor, try adding a teaspoon of Dijon mustard to the glaze mixture.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the vegetables and glaze mixture separately up to a day in advance. Store them in airtight containers in the refrigerator, then toss and roast when ready to serve.
Can I use frozen vegetables?
Fresh vegetables work best for roasting, but you can use frozen green beans and carrots. Thaw them completely and pat dry to remove excess moisture before tossing with the glaze.
What other vegetables work well with this glaze?

How do I store leftovers?
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ave until warmed through.
